Vodafone has revealed that it will be the network provider for the iPhone 3G in Australia, Italy, New Zealand, Portugal, the Czech Republic, Egypt, Greece, India, South Africa and Turkey later this year.
Australia, Italy, New Zealand and Portugal will be the first Vodafone markets to offer customers iPhone 3G for purchase on 11 July. iPhone 3G will be available via Vodafone on both prepay and contract price plans. Other markets will follow later this year and full details of specific launch dates and price plans will be made available soon by individual Vodafone operating companies. Customers in Vodafones 10 markets where iPhone 3G will be available can pre-register online and in retail stores in the next few days.
